Merry Island, Bc vs Portalegre Climate & Distance Between

Portugal flag
  • The distance between Merry Island, Bc, Canada and Portalegre, Portugal is approximately 8,353 km or 5,191 mi.
  • To reach Merry Island, Bc in this distance one would set out from Portalegre bearing 323°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Merry Island, Bc bearing 225.8° or SW .
  • Merry Island, Bc has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b) whereas Portalegre has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
  • The average annual temperature is 4.6 °C (8.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.3 °C (2.3°F) less in Merry Island, Bc.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 139.9 mm (5.5 in) more which is equivalent to 139.9 l/m² (3.43 US gal/ft²) or 1,399,000 l/ha (149,562 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/6 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.1° lower in Merry Island, Bc than in Portalegre.
